Cherai Beach in Cochin,kerala
Hi
i would like some info on Cherai beach,kerala. My budget is around Rs 5000 for 6 people and we plan to reach there by sat morning and leave by sunday evening.Are there any hotels there and could anyone pass some info abt the tariff. And is it worth spending two days and one night over there Muteflower ![]() |

cherai
there is a place called seamans village in cherai.
The room cost 500 Rupees, you dont need to book, just arrive and im sure you will get rooms. Yes, two days at cherai will be just good enough |
